Alistair Johnston's Hamstring Recovery Hits a Snag for Celtic
Celtic and Canada's dependable right-back, Alistair Johnston, has unfortunately encountered a setback in his ongoing recovery from a long-term hamstring injury. This news comes directly from manager Martin O'Neill, confirming that the initial timeline for Johnston's return will now be extended. It's a frustrating development for the player, the club, and the Canadian national team, as they eagerly await his full fitness.
The Nature of Hamstring Injury Setbacks
Hamstring injuries are notoriously challenging for professional athletes, particularly those in high-intensity roles like a full-back who relies on explosive speed and endurance. A 'setback' typically means that the healing process has either slowed considerably, or there's been a minor re-aggravation of the muscle. This isn't uncommon in sports rehabilitation, as the balance between pushing for recovery and preventing further damage is incredibly delicate. Such delays often require a complete re-evaluation of the rehabilitation plan, potentially involving more rest, different therapeutic approaches, and a more cautious return to training protocols.
For an athlete, these setbacks can be mentally taxing, extending their time away from competitive play and the camaraderie of the team. It underscores the patience and resilience required throughout the long journey of injury recovery.
Johnston's Importance to Club and Country
Alistair Johnston has quickly established himself as a pivotal figure for Celtic since his move, known for his relentless work rate, defensive tenacity, and surprising contributions in attack. His consistent performances make him a vital cog in Celtic's machine, especially as they compete fiercely for domestic honours and aim to make an impact in European competitions. His absence leaves a noticeable void on the right side of the defence, forcing tactical adjustments and placing greater demands on other squad members to fill his boots.
Beyond his club commitments, Johnston is also an indispensable member of the Canadian men's national team. As Canada continues to build and prepare for major international tournaments, having their key players fit and firing is paramount. His leadership, experience, and defensive prowess are highly valued within the national setup, making this setback a concern for national team selectors as they plan for upcoming international windows. His versatility and ability to perform at a high level are crucial assets for both club and country.
The Road Ahead for Alistair Johnston
Manager Martin O'Neill's confirmation of the setback signals a need for a revised and even more meticulous approach to Johnston's recovery. While specific details about the nature of the setback are usually kept private, the focus will undoubtedly be on ensuring a full, robust recovery rather than rushing him back prematurely. The priority is to prevent any further complications that could lead to a longer-term issue. This revised plan will likely involve:
- Intensified Physiotherapy: Tailored exercises to strengthen the hamstring and surrounding muscle groups.
- Gradual Load Progression: A carefully managed increase in physical activity, from light training to full match fitness.
- Constant Monitoring: Regular assessments by medical staff to track healing and prevent re-injury.
- Mental Support: Providing the necessary psychological support to help the player cope with the frustration of a prolonged absence.
This delay means Johnston will unfortunately miss additional crucial fixtures for Celtic, potentially impacting their strategic planning for the remainder of the season. For Canada, it could influence squad selections for future international gatherings. Everyone associated with both teams will be hoping for a smooth and complete recovery, allowing Johnston to return to his best form without any further interruptions.
